What is the disease that makes girls often faint?

Fainting is a sudden, short-term loss of consciousness caused by temporary ischemia of the brain due to various reasons, which is called "syncope" in medicine. So, what disease causes girls to faint frequently?

1. Cardiac syncope

It refers to fainting caused by a sudden decrease or cessation of cardiac output due to heart disease, which is mostly caused by arrhythmia and organic heart disease. Common arrhythmias include distorted sinus syndrome, atrioventricular block and other bradycardia or arrest, and tachycardia arrhythmias such as ventricular fibrillation and ventricular tachycardia, which cause a decrease in preload and lead to fainting. Organic heart diseases, such as acute myocardial infarction, cardiac myxoma, hypertrophic obstructive cardiomyopathy, congenital cyanotic heart disease, etc. can all cause fainting. Cardiogenic syncope is more common in the elderly, lasts for a long time, and is a serious condition. The elderly with heart disease should communicate with cardiovascular and cerebrovascular disease specialists for treatment, and use pacemakers and implantable cardioverter defibrillators when necessary.

2. Vasovagal syncope

This type is more common and occurs more frequently in young people. Usually, there are fixed causes of illness, such as urination, cough, pain, anxiety, fear, hot weather, excessive exercise, and fasting. Sometimes there are no symptoms before the onset of syncope, and it will recover quickly without complications. Sometimes there will be a decrease in blood pressure and/or heart rate. This type of syncope can usually be cured by special exercises under the guidance of a doctor. Very few people need to be treated with drugs or pacemakers.

3. Hypotensive syncope during standing position

It is common in the elderly or those who are bedridden for a long time. The main symptoms are blacking of the eyes and fainting after a sudden change in posture. The preventive measures are to stand up slowly or with support, and not to squat for a long time.

4. Cerebral syncope

It is caused by circulatory obstruction in the brain blood vessels or the blood vessels that mainly supply blood to the head, resulting in a temporary lack of blood supply to the brain. It is common in the elderly, and common causes include transient cerebral ischemia, spinal syncope, and large arteritis. Preventive measures include avoiding cardiovascular and cerebrovascular arteriosclerosis, reducing cerebral vasospasm, taking medication regularly, and regular follow-up visits.

In summary, there are many causes of fainting, vasovagal syncope is the most common, and cardiac syncope is the most dangerous. When the disease occurs, the person who has fainted should be placed in a supine position or with the lower limbs pulled up to increase the blood volume of the brain. Loosen your collar and turn your head to one side. Send the patient to the hospital immediately, and choose to do electrocardiogram, cardiac ultrasound, head CT, blood sugar level, tilt test and other examinations according to different situations. After the cause of the disease is determined, prevent recurrence under the guidance of a doctor.
